Output 31622ef49ec1281a0c78a030cb8b00e1df5c97686ef66c331ecc32846779484e:1

value
64420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e5099c72fdcc36dee09527ac3d2a5764117c22 OP_EQUAL
address
3KNEiNgBaxwhPQxcwBvTHYr6aKoZpDPSa9
transaction
31622ef49ec1281a0c78a030cb8b00e1df5c97686ef66c331ecc32846779484e
spent
true